Interest rates are very low for the chinese loans which is something positive (well negotiated by PML-N govt.)

 

Infrastructure development is generally welcomed since it reduces different costs and increases opportunities for revenue. Certain projects such as Lahore-Sialkot-Rawalpindi motorway are beneficial in long-term as these cities are industrial hubs and produce massive outputs for domestic consumption across Pakistan (from sanitary to steel products). E-35 expressway project gives opportunities to areas like Mansehra, Battal etc. with tourism potential as well.

 

 

For overall development and plan, you have to identify your strengths and core competencies eg. Balochistan has natural raw materials and land availability. Now the thing is you need to evaluate how you can add value through competencies and which international market or domestic "market gaps" can be filled in through those competencies (increasing exports and reducing exports).

For instance, you can manufacture product X, Y and Z (using competencies identified) which are currently being imported, provided you take debt for import of P&M, Infrastructure etc.

 

 

However there are many more challenges to this indirectly including culture, skilled labour and productivity, security etc.

Another basic issue is that we have not actually identified our competencies, we have not done enough R&D to evaluate what areas like Interior Sindh, Balochistan or even KPK bring to the table differently. 

 

 

Pakistan's problems since PTI took over have been economic mis-management, they don't know how to align things and are cursed with dysfunctional decision making. Massive increases in energy costs and devaluation have demoralized large scale manufacturing, all the "growth projections" have been reversed. Ideally before even thinking about devaluation, they should have created import alternatives. PTI has given "tax targets" to FBR which are unrealistic and this has lead to FBR giving bamboo to current tax payers rather than expanding tax base. Government is absolutely inept and has no clue how behavioral impacts work. God knows what their economic KPIs are. 

 

In an ideal coherent scenario, Pakistan needs to think what it is uniquely good at and emphasize on development of those competencies for ultimate export targets. If it drifts away and invests blindly without a plan, purpose or vision, sustainable growth will not be possible.
